What the Test Measures
This test specifically measures the levels of IgM antibodies against myelin-associated glycoprotein (MAG). Elevated levels of these antibodies can indicate an autoimmune response, which may lead to demyelination and neurological issues.

Understanding Your Results
Results from the Myelin Associated Glycoprotein MAG IgM Test will indicate the presence or absence of IgM antibodies. A higher level may suggest an autoimmune response, while normal levels can indicate that no autoimmune disorder is present.
